This is good, even better the 2nd day. Add a pan of corn bread and you're all set on a cold windy night

Ham & Cabbage Soup

1 cup of Diced ham
1 cup cubed chicken
2 potatoes peeled and diced
2 Carrots diced
2 celery diced
1 can diced tomatoes
1/2 head cabbage, sliced thin
2 cans chicken broth or bullion
1/2 tsp basil
1 bay leaf
1/2 tsp garlic minced or to taste
black pepper/salt to taste

Put every thing in pot. (Good for crockpot all day cooking.) Cook until done. You may have to add more chicken stock or tomato juice.
